Environmental, Health & Safety Manager – New Johnsonville, Tennessee
We are seeking an Environmental, Health & Safety Manager to join our growing EHS team at Chemours’ New Johnsonville facility. This role reports directly to the Plant Manager and offers relocation assistance for the right candidate.
Responsibilities- Provide leadership, guidance, technical problem solving, training, improvement, and implementation support for Training, Environmental compliance, workplace safety, and Process Safety Management (PSM) programs across the site.
- Strategically manage team resources to ensure corporate and regulatory compliance is met.
- Drive implementation of EHS best practices across the Johnsonville site, looking for opportunities to streamline, standardize, and simplify processes that enhance employee engagement and achieve safety excellence.
- Provide coaching and EHS leadership to site staff and area leaders to challenge conventional thinking and drive excellence in EHS performance.
- Partner with site and area leadership to drive personal accountability at all levels of the organization so that EHS policies are understood and implemented consistently.
- Actively participate in organizations to promote environmental, health and safety beyond the Chemours Johnsonville site to partners and the community.
- Assist with operational learning, injury and illness classification, regulatory and agency interactions, 1st and 2nd party auditing, and community concerns as required.
- Develop and support site EHS strategy and objectives annually.
